Monkeys to China for breeding purposes: Ministry | Sri Lanka News


The Agriculture Ministry revealed today that the toque monkeys are to be taken to China for breeding purposes, Ministry Secretary Gunadasa Samarasinghe said.

He said a Chinese company called Animal Breeding Limited had requested the 100,000 toque monkeys. To implement the request, the ministry opened a forum to express the views of various parties. Environmentalists, farmers, the public, the tourism industry, religious leaders and scientists can express their views on exporting the monkeys.

“While collecting acceptable, justified and better ideas, the ministry is hoping to take the best decision when sending the toque monkeys to China.

“The ministry is hoping to remove monkeys from areas where a large extent of crops are being destroyed by them. There are no intentions of removing monkeys from forests and conservation areas,” the ministry secretary added. (Chaturanga Pradeep Samarawickrama)
